Output 1876c65778c89e1605e9d64c6b66e598e4c1ab98a0cdad0bcc4008b9c0325f14:3

value
2428000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a70a4be74548a5ea2b1539480e2551faf7e257d OP_EQUAL
address
3FmcvhHYSGzM5c4kwGRvm78u8iJjkHt2rS
transaction
1876c65778c89e1605e9d64c6b66e598e4c1ab98a0cdad0bcc4008b9c0325f14
spent
true